Access Control: A Deep Dive into System Configurations
Access control systems are fundamental to safeguarding sensitive data. A robust access control system ensures that only authorized personnel can access specific resources. This requires meticulous system parameters to define user roles, privileges, and access tiers.
Well-defined access control policies are essential for mitigating potential threats. These policies precisely define the scope of user permissions based on their roles and responsibilities.
To achieve a secure environment, administrators must implement a multi-layered access control architecture. This may involve techniques such as:
* Identity Validation:
Verifying the credentials of users attempting to enter to a system.
* Authorization: Determining which systems authorized users can access.
* Log Monitoring:
Tracking and analyzing user activity to monitor suspicious behavior.
Periodically auditing access control configurations is crucial for maintaining a secure system. As user roles change, access control procedures must be modified accordingly to ensure continued protection.
